Intel Processor N150 vs Intel Core Ultra 7 256V

We compared two laptop CPUs: Intel Processor N150 with 4 cores 0.1GHz and Intel Core Ultra 7 256V with 8 cores 2.2G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Processor N150 's Advantages
Lower TDP (6W vs 37W)
Intel Core Ultra 7 256V 's Advantages
Better graphics card performance
Higher specification of memory (8533 vs 4800)
Larger memory bandwidth (136GB/s vs 38.4GB/s)
Newer PCIe version (5.0 vs 3)
Higher base frequency (2.2GHz vs 0.1GHz)
Larger L3 cache size (12MB vs 6MB)
More modern manufacturing process (3nm vs 10nm)
